One important lesson I learned from studying the way early Buddhist monks practiced the spiritual life was the lesson of readiness. (1) Before a person can make any progress on the spiritual path of his or her choice, they must be ready to undertake the path. I have come to see readiness as the foundational step on any religion's spiritual path.
